I'm running a one day workshop in Belfast this weekend entitled "Keeping up with research: does it make any difference to our practice?".  Here's a downloadable copy of the 50 or so slide initial Powerpoint presentation.  I'll also be giving the trainee cognitive therapists a series of exercises to try. Here are a set of these workshop slides.  They overlap considerably with the rather iconoclastic first presentation, but also provide a jumping off point for four major areas we focussed on ... 1.) how expertise is developed (Anders Ericsson's work).  2.) the importance of rapid feedback on how well things are going (balancing evidence-based practice with practice-based evidence).
